BY CHRYSEE G. SAMILLANO

The newlyweds Dexter Francisco and April Taño-Francisco with Rev. Salvador Parpa Jr.*

Dexter Francisco and April Taño exchanged marriage vows at rites officiated by Rev. Salvador Parpa, Jr. in Bacolod City on September 11.

Dexter is the son of Danilo and Felicidad Francisco of Bicol, while April is the only daughter of Alfredo Taño, Sr. and Eunice Abong-Taño of Bacolod City.

Best man was Jucir Tolentino, while the matron of honor was Christine Pasaylo.

Groomsmen were Dennis Francisco, Marc Crisanto Paul Luego, and Rodolfo Akol lll, while the bridesmaids were Crisna Esther Abong, Sheera Darling Francisco and Princess Francisco.
